Speculation surrounding a potential Blackrock $XRP ETF has resurfaced after Jake Claver, chairman of Digital Ascension Group, suggested the asset manager could eventually launch such a product. His comments also pointed to broader XRPL adoption and institutional discussion around digital asset infrastructure as factors supporting $XRP’s outlook.
The comments came during a June 15 interview with Deep Dive Podcast host Rachel Wolfson. Claver also founded Digital Wealth Partners, manages Syndicately’s SPV investment platform, and works with high and ultra-high net worth families navigating digital asset investments.
Emphasizing his bullishness on $XRP, he predicted:
“I think that we could see a Blackrock ETF.”
The ETF remark was only one part of his broader $XRP thesis. Claver tied that view to XRPL adoption, tokenization, and institutional settlement infrastructure. His comments framed $XRP as a candidate for deeper use in financial markets, not only as an asset that could benefit from a new investment product.
Settlement infrastructure added urgency to the forecast. Claver said the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ication (SWIFT) and the Depository Trust & Clearing Corporation (DTCC) were preparing initiatives related to real-time settlement for June 28.
The executive argued that wider institutional use of $XRP could require a significantly higher price before the asset is used in that capacity.
The remarks follow earlier market discussion involving Blackrock and a potential $XRP ETF. Nate Geraci, president of Novadius Wealth Management and co-founder of The ETF Institute, previously said he expected Blackrock to file for a spot $XRP ETF, arguing that the asset manager would eventually expand beyond bitcoin and ether products.
